Method: TestApplicationsManagementClient#test_create

Defined in:
lib/authing_ruby/test/mini_test/TestApplicationsManagementClient.rb

#test_createObject

创建应用ruby ./lib/test/mini_test/TestApplicationsManagementClient.rb -n test_create



24
25
26
27
28
29
30
31
32
33
34
35
36
37
# File 'lib/authing_ruby/test/mini_test/TestApplicationsManagementClient.rb', line 24

def test_create
  res = @managementClient.applications.create({
	name: '应用名称1000',
	identifier: 'app1000',
})
  json = JSON.parse(res.body)
  assert(json["code"] == 200, res.body)
  # 错误情况1
  # {"code":2039,"message":"域名已被占用"}

  # 清理工作:删掉这个应用
  appid = json.dig("data", "id")
  @managementClient.applications.delete(appid)
end